Unfair competition matters can devastate a business. We provide comprehensive service in this area, including (but not limited to):

  • Drafting enforceable non-compete and sales representative agreements
  • Litigating breaches of restrictive covenant agreements
  • Trade Secrets Act claims and related unfair competition torts
  • Counseling employers on protecting proprietary information

As an employer, you have a right and a duty to protect the integrity of your business. Our lawyers have many years of experience pursuing unfair competition law cases. Sales representatives tend to be more prone to falling into the lure of a competing business’ proposition. Being aware of and having offered the agreements that govern interactions with competing businesses can prevent the necessity for legal action in the future.
